Lyman to seek additional bids after cemetery and alley grading estimates exceed $5,000
Summary
Council reviewed increased estimates to grade the cemetery and town alleys and instructed staff to use the small works roster to obtain at least two additional bids once funding is secured.

Council reviewed updated estimates from contractor Arne Svendsen to grade the town cemetery and alleys and noted that costs have risen since the last time the work was done. Clerk informed the council the project total will exceed $5,000 and that state small‑works procurement rules require obtaining additional bids from a small works roster.
Mayor Eddie Hills said the town will need to secure funding before soliciting the required additional bids. No specific funding source or timeline was approved at the May 12 meeting; council discussion focused on procurement steps to comply with the small works roster requirement.
